About: For eight years, I volunteered with the Wake County Animal Center in Raleigh, NC, where I fostered 60 dogs—from newborn puppies to senior dogs and every age and personality in between. While I’m not a certified dog trainer, I’ve worked with pups who had anxiety, reactivity, resource guarding, medical needs, and even deafness (I taught one dog 15 different signs!). I’ve handled recovery care after surgery, heartworm treatment, skin and eye issues, potty training, and medication routines that required attention multiple times a day. I feel confident and comfortable with any dog—big or small, shy or hyper, special needs or seniors. Through my years of volunteering at a busy municipal shelter, I’ve developed a strong ability to read dog body language—whether that means giving space to a nervous dog, redirecting rough play, or stepping in safely if a situation escalates. I also know how to interrupt and break up dog fights safely, though I do everything possible to prevent them from happening in the first place!
